Focus On The Future Rittal climate control guarantees progress destruction. Rittal is searching for ways to replace the coolant R34a and reduce emissions. During the operation of an air conditioner only 3% of the CO 2-creation in the environment is the result of the coolant, the other 97% is the result of the electric power consumption. All Rittal climate control products have been consistently designed for energy-efficiency. Our newest feature, Rittal Liquid Cooling offers an innovative approach to enclosure cooling with effective and progressive climate control options. Many companies talk about the future, Rittal is shaping it. We have chosen a forward-thinking approach for climate control development and environmental protection is the focus of our research. Rittal has been the trendsetter in the climate control market for many years. Since 992 Pro Ozone has become the global term for environmentally friendly cooling technology. At one time the only environmental issue was to replace the coolants R22 and R2, that were destroying the ozone layer. Now we are dealing with the greenhouse effect, a result of the ozone layer ENVIRONMENTALLY FRIENDLY COOLING TECNOLOGY istory of successes for Rittal innovations 983 eginning of Rittal s enclosure climate control production. The focus of our development and design at the time: Reducing strain on the environment with energy efficient and highly effective equipment. 988 First enclosure air conditioner equipped with microcontroller. 992 First air conditioner without the coolant R22/R2, Pro Ozone. 994 First Design-air conditioner line, with updated microcontroller. 2002 Rittal TopTherm, the new generation of air conditioners and the beginning of Rittal s liquid cooling concept. Air/air heat exchangers use the cooler ambient air to effectively dissipate heat from the enclosure by using hermetically sealed air circuits (using a counter current, or cross-flow concept). Ambient air and dust are unable to ingress the enclosure. Air/water heat exchangers cool the enclosure interior by integration into an existing cooling water cycle or connection to a chiller. This makes efficient dissipation of high heat loads under the most extreme conditions possible. Filter fans with a very low profile design, low noise and high output. Prerequisite: cool, relatively clean ambient air. 9 Climate control: Rack-mounted air conditioners, rack-mounted fans and blowers. Cooling is most effective when installed directly below the electronic equipment. eaters prevent the formation of condensation. This is especially valuable for outside locations or unheated rooms. Selection criteria Air Conditioners Integrated cooling technology The combination of enclosure and cooling components provides excellent cooling, cost savings and reduced assembly time. Intelligent control Rittal offers basic and comfort control versions for operational reliability. oth versions offer a comprehensive range of functions. Essential control electronics are well protected and cooled in the inner circuit. oth versions have the following properties: Three voltage options: 5 V, 230 V, 400/460 V 3~ Integrated start-up delay and door limit switch function Icing protection function Monitoring of all motors Phase monitoring for threephase units Roof-mounted air conditioners Requirement oriented routing of cooling air in the internal circuit is possible with up to four cold air outlet openings and the optional use of ducts. In the external circuit, the heated air is expelled to the rear, left, right, and optionally upwards. This allows enclosures to be bayed together or to be installed close to the wall. asic controller: Visualization of the operating status by a LED display Switching hysteresis: 5 K Floating fault signal contact in case of over temperature Set-point adjustable from the outside by a potentiometer (setting range 20 55 C (68 3 F)) Wall-mounted air conditioners Depending on the space and design requirements, internal mounting, partial internal mounting and external mounting are all possible. Effective cold air dissipation throughout the enclosure is achieved by large distances between the air intake and outlet openings. Comfort controller: Switching hysteresis: 2 0 K preset to 5 K System alarm, individually configurable for 2 floating fault signal contacts Visualization of the current enclosure internal temperature and all system messages on the display Storage of all system states in the log file Optional extension card for integration into superordinate remote monitoring systems (CMC) 22

Air Conditioners Wall-mounted air conditioners Practical and stylish The mounting cutout is selected depending on the mounting type: external, internal or partial internal mount. This makes optimum use of the available space. Effective air routing inside the enclosure The large distance between the air intake and outlet in the internal circuit makes wall-mounted air conditioners particularly effective. This ensures optimum air dissipation inside the enclosure, and air short-circuits are avoided.
